Feel : Book Review

"Feel: Robbie Williams" is an captivating and comprehensive biography penned by Chris Heath that delves deep into the extraordinary life and career of the iconic pop star. With an engaging writing style, Heath takes readers on a whirlwind journey alongside Robbie, providing an intimate and honest portrayal of his rise to fame, personal struggles, and ultimately, his personal growth.

One of the remarkable aspects of this biography is its exploration of Robbie's vulnerabilities and insecurities. Through extensive research and interviews with Robbie himself, as well as his friends, family, and colleagues, Heath paints a raw and authentic picture of the challenges he faced. From his battles with self-doubt, addiction, and mental health, to his determination to overcome these obstacles and find redemption, readers witness Robbie's journey towards self-discovery and acceptance.

Moreover, "Feel" also offers insights into the creative process behind Robbie's music. The book provides a glimpse into the evolution of his sound and the inspiration behind some of his most iconic songs. This aspect of the biography adds an extra layer of depth, making it an intriguing read not only for fans of Robbie Williams but also for music enthusiasts interested in the behind-the-scenes workings of the industry.

Chris Heath's book, "Feel: Robbie Williams," has garnered a variety of reviews, with readers expressing differing perspectives on the work. Many readers found the book to be captivating and insightful, offering a deep exploration of pop star Robbie Williams' life. They appreciated the comprehensive analysis of his career, personal struggles, and path to fame. The author's ability to effectively convey Williams' emotions and vulnerability was particularly lauded, with readers praising the engaging and well-researched writing style. These readers felt that the book provided valuable insights into the challenges present within the world of celebrity.

However, some reviewers criticized the book for its alleged bias, arguing that it solely glorified Robbie Williams. They felt that the author failed to present a balanced perspective or delve into the negative aspects of Williams' life. Additionally, some readers found the writing style repetitive and excessively verbose, which hindered their engagement with the story.

Another point of contention among readers was the book's heavy focus on the financial aspects of Williams' career. While some appreciated these insights into the music industry, others felt that it overshadowed important elements of his life. These readers were hoping for more personal anecdotes and stories to gain a deeper understanding of the artist.

While many praised the book's extensive research, others criticized it for a lack of originality. These reviewers believed that the information presented in the book could easily be obtained through interviews and online sources, making it devoid of new insights or analysis.

In conclusion, "Feel: Robbie Williams" has elicited a range of reactions from readers. While many found it to be a captivating and insightful read, providing valuable insights into Williams' life, others felt that it lacked balance and originality.
